Output 93cdfb5137afde676c09d04834791f890243137b6856abee614e9739d22a7aee:1

value
68097597
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95b7134c2ee323d18f94e439b0f8ef7094bb3c8f OP_EQUALVERIFY OP_CHECKSIG
address
1EecztEA2FEWpurtv6LrTLtawvhk23J4QQ
transaction
93cdfb5137afde676c09d04834791f890243137b6856abee614e9739d22a7aee
spent
true